easy_dev991
604 subscribers
22 photos
16 videos
3 files
159 links
Делюсь интересными находками/лайфхаками в процессе разработки под iOS, и возможно ты найдешь что-то полезное для себя!

GitHub: https://github.com/easydev991
Download Telegram
#ios #swift #concurrency #preconcurrency

Вот этот код из документации приводит к предупреждению и ошибке:

import NotificationCenter

Task {
let center = UNUserNotificationCenter.current()
let settings = await center.notificationSettings()
}


Для исправления достаточно добавить @preconcurrency перед импортом:

@preconcurrency import NotificationCenter
// ...


Вот так одним действием можно избавиться сразу и от предупреждения, и от ошибки 😎
🔥51